美文网首页
使用gephi生成社交网络图

使用gephi生成社交网络图

作者: SteveGuRen | 来源:发表于2017-04-12 10:01 被阅读3748次

    gephi

    gephi的下载地址:https://gephi.org/

    打开效果图

    gephi提供了大量的插件,因为前端js经常使用的是json格式的,因此在工具--》插件,安装一个叫JSONExporter的插件,之后每次要输出json的时候都可以在文件--》输出--》图文件里面将设置好的图以json的格式保存

    概览字体设置

    gephi默认的字体是Arial Bold,因此如果现实标签的时候可能会中文乱码,可以选择字体为微软雅黑或者宋体,这样中文乱码就不会出现了。

    字体设置

    如何显示节点标签,修改背景颜色

    下图箭头指示的各个按钮从左到右的功能一次是修改背景颜色、截图、是否显示节点标签、是否显示边、边具备节点颜色,需要修改什么自行点击按钮设置即可


    图面板

    利用gephi简单的将杂乱分布的点和边优化显示

    • 通过文件--》import spreadsheet...分别导入边和节点,导入格式是开源excel格式csv,里面的每一行的字段是以逗号隔开的,选择的格式是UTF-8,导入之后,可以看到一堆黑色的杂乱无章的边和图
    导入节点 导入边 导入完成的图
    • 通过布局算法Fruchterman Reingold优化显示,由于Frunchterman Reingold只有三个参数可以设置,相对来说比较简单,学过物理的应该都知道,重力越大两点之间吸引力越强,也就是说,节点距离就会变得越小,而速度设置会提高节点在运行过程中重新分布的速度,区的设置会影响图的面积大小,点击运行即可以将点以近圆的方式分布
    参数设置 运行效果图

    相关文章

      网友评论

          本文标题:使用gephi生成社交网络图

          本文链接:https://www.haomeiwen.com/subject/fiwpattx.html